Crunchy Veggies: Nature's Tooth Scrubbers
Crunchy vegetables work as nature's effective tooth scrubbers, promoting dental health and wellness in a tasty method. Their coarse structures help to remove plaque and food fragments from the teeth while boosting periodontals, thereby enhancing overall oral health. Carrots, celery, and cucumbers are prime instances of such vegetables, providing a gratifying crunch that urges chewing. As people munch on these raw thrills, they unintentionally add to a cleaner mouth.
Moreover, the act of chewing these vegetables enhances saliva manufacturing, which aids reduce the effects of acids and safeguards versus cavities. Saliva additionally contains minerals that can strengthen tooth enamel, additional helping in oral health. Integrating crunchy vegetables right into daily treats or dishes not only sustains healthy and balanced teeth but likewise provides necessary minerals and vitamins advantageous for general wellness. A vibrant plate of these fresh alternatives can make a nourishing and enticing enhancement to any diet, ensuring that dental health and wellness is both pleasurable and efficient.
Dairy Products Delights: Calcium-Rich Foods for Strong Teeth
Calcium is necessary for keeping strong teeth and stopping degeneration. Dairy products, such as cheese, yogurt, and milk, function as several of the very best resources of this important mineral. Their consumption can substantially affect oral health and wellness by reinforcing enamel and supporting total dental hygiene.

Relevance of Calcium Consumption
While lots of elements add to oral health, adequate calcium intake is important for keeping strong teeth. Calcium plays a considerable function in the development and preservation of tooth structure, as it assists to strengthen enamel and stop degeneration. This mineral not only supports the formation of teeth but likewise help in the remineralization procedure, which aids repair work early indications of enamel erosion. Additionally, calcium adds to the total wellness of gums and bones that support teeth. Insufficient calcium levels can cause damaged teeth, increasing the risk of tooth cavities and periodontal illness. As an outcome, including calcium-rich foods right into one's diet regimen is crucial for maintaining both dental health and total wellness, making sure that teeth stay resilient and solid gradually.
Finest Dairy Products Sources
Dairy items attract attention as a few of the very best resources of calcium, necessary for advertising solid teeth. Cheese, milk, and yogurt are specifically rich in this critical mineral, making them exceptional choices for keeping dental health and wellness. Milk supplies a creamy structure and a huge selection of nutrients, including vitamin D, which aids calcium absorption. Yogurt, with its probiotics, not just adds to calcium intake however additionally sustains overall oral wellness. Cheese, particularly hard selections like cheddar, helps boost saliva production, which naturally cleans up teeth and neutralizes acids. Integrating these dairy delights right into everyday diets can contribute considerably to developing more powerful teeth and enhancing overall dental wellness. They supply scrumptious means to support dental wellness while appreciating mouthwatering tastes.
Effect On Dental Wellness
The consumption of calcium-rich dairy products plays an important role in keeping perfect oral health and wellness. Foods such as yogurt, milk, and cheese are not just superb sources of calcium yet additionally advertise the remineralization of tooth enamel. This process aids enhance teeth and decreases the threat of dental caries. In addition, dairy items include casein, a protein that aids in neutralizing acids generated by bacteria in the mouth. This safety effect adds to a healthier oral setting. The act of eating cheese stimulates saliva manufacturing, which furthermore assists clean away food bits and bacteria. Inevitably, incorporating dairy products right into one's diet regimen can significantly boost oral wellness, making it a vital part for those seeking to keep healthy and balanced and solid teeth.

Moisturizing Drinks: The Importance of Water for Oral Health
While several might forget the duty of hydration in dental health and wellness, water is vital for preserving strong teeth and gums. Enough water intake aids to remove food bits and bacteria, reducing the danger of cavities and gum tissue condition. Saliva, which is mainly made up of water, plays a pivotal duty in neutralizing acids produced by bacteria in the mouth, consequently shielding tooth enamel.
Additionally, remaining properly hydrated warranties that the mouth continues to be moist, which can protect against dry mouth-- a problem that increases the possibility of oral concerns. Consuming water additionally sustains total bodily features, contributing to peak wellness that indirectly benefits oral health.
Picking water over sweet or acidic drinks can considerably reduce the risk of dental cavity. Incorporating ample water right into everyday routines is a basic yet reliable strategy for promoting oral health and wellness and ensuring that one's smile remains brilliant and healthy and balanced.
